COWDEN v. AETNA CAS. & CURETY CO.


389 Pa. 459 (1957)

Cowden, Appellant, v. Aetna Casualty and Surety Company.

Supreme Court of Pennsylvania.

June 28, 1957.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Earl F. Reed, with him Joseph E. Madva, Earl F. Reed, Jr. and Thorp, Reed & Armstrong, for appellant.

Charles E. Kenworthey, with him Gilbert J. Helwig and Reed, Smith, Shaw & McClay, for appellee.

Before STERN, C.J., STEARNE, JONES, MUSMANNO and ARNOLD, JJ.


OPINION BY MR. CHIEF JUSTICE JONES, June 28, 1957:

This appeal grows out of an action in trespass by the plaintiff for the recovery of damages from the liability-insurer of his automobile trucks because of the insurer's refusal to participate in a proposed settlement of a law suit against the insured and another jointly for personal injuries sustained by a third person in a collision between one of the insured's trucks and...
